XDJP.DE vs. BBJP - Expense Ratio Comparison

XDJP.DE has a 0.09% expense ratio, which is lower than BBJP's 0.19% expense ratio. Despite the difference, both funds are considered low-cost compared to the broader market, where average expense ratios usually range from 0.3% to 0.9%.

XDJP.DE tracks TOPIX TR JPY, while BBJP tracks Morningstar Japan Target Market Exposure Index. They also come from different issuers: Xtrackers and JPMorgan. Their fees differ too: 0.09% for XDJP.DE and 0.19% for BBJP.
